PURPOSE OF GCS SOFTWARE
• GCS Software responsible for:– Receiving Data from the CanSat at Ground Station
in real time– Storing the received raw data– Processing this raw data in real time to show
meaningful data in presentable manner via graphs or map plots

1: PORTING DATA FROM USB TO A FILE
• Configuration steps once you download javaxcomm:• comm.jar should be placed in:
%JAVA_HOME%/lib%JAVA_HOME%/jre/lib/ext
• win32com.dll should be placed in:%JAVA_HOME%/bin%JAVA_HOME%/jre/bin%windir%System32
• javax.comm.properties should be placed in:%JAVA_HOME%/lib%JAVA_HOME%/jre/lib

2: PROCESSING & PLOTTING DATA
• For real time plotting of data you can use an open source library. For java an example open source library is LiveGraph. It is available for download at: http://www.live-graph.org/download.html

3: TRAJECTORY PLOTTING IN GOOGLE EARTH
• GPS data can be viewed in Google Earth• For this we need to create an appropriate KML
file• Just like HTML file is to a browser, KML file is
to Google Earth application• Let’s see a typical KML file• We have to auto-generate this KML file from
the GPS data

REAL WORLD PROBLEMS
• The raw data we get from the CanSat may have errors as loss of data or the data being incorrect due to wireless mode of transfer from the CanSat to the GCS
• A real world ground station software needs to take care of these
